Recalling, we can detect two clear waves of subscription growth in the United States. The first was sparked by the political election of Donald Trump, with many more youthful and liberal voters aiming to sustain magazines that might hold the President to account. This year's uptick might be partly driven by a brand-new political election cycle yet likewise by author strategies to restrict the quantity of material individuals can see completely free integrated with unique deals.

This year we carried out a 2nd more detailed study in three nations (USA, UK, and Norway) to recognize more concerning patterns and mindsets to online information payment. This study clearly reveals that a few huge national news brand names have been the biggest champions in all 3 countries. Around fifty percent of those that sign up for any kind of online or combined plan in the United States utilize the New york city Times or the Washington Message and a comparable proportion sign up for either The Times or the Telegraph in the UK, however in much smaller sized numbers.

For more outcomes from our comprehensive pay study see: How and Why Individuals are Spending For Online News Donations for information are reasonably new, though Wikipedia and National Public Radio have actually generated much of their earnings by doing this for several years.


In the United States 4% currently say they donate cash to a news organisation, 3% in Norway, and 1% in the UK. The Guardian has one of the most successful contribution designs of any significant brand name, with over a million individuals having contributed in the in 2015. According to our data, virtually half of all the relatively small number of contributions in the UK (42%) most likely to the Guardian, yet most are one-off, with a typical settlement of less than 15.
